Yes, Hot. But A Few Storms

We are in the midst of yet another 100° day across north Texas, the 2pm hourly weather round-up made it official at DFW:

With the Heat Index it makes for the kind of summer heat that warrants a Heat Advisory (it continues until 7pm tonight):

 

There are numerous outflow boundaries in place for previous storms. More of them are along the Red River and just to the south, that's where the best chance exists for afternoon/early evening storms:

We are already seeing them pop up and expect them to increase in coverage as the afternoon wears on. I'll be updating the radar via Twitter ( @cbs11jeffrey) and our Facebook page (CBS11 Weather). We could get some strong downbursts with these storms along with some lightning.
